Free Spins
Free Spins are the most common bonus feature. They're typically triggered by landing three or more Scatter symbols anywhere on the reels. During free spins:
- You spin without deducting from your balance
- Many games apply multipliers that increase with each spin
- Some games allow free spins to be retriggered within the feature itself
- Expanded or sticky Wilds are often added to make the feature more rewarding
Always check how many free spins are awarded and whether the game applies a fixed multiplier or a growing one — this dramatically affects the feature's potential.
Wild Symbols: Types and Variations
| Wild Type | How It Works |
|---|---|
| Standard Wild | Substitutes for any regular symbol to complete wins |
| Expanding Wild | Expands to fill the entire reel when it lands |
| Sticky Wild | Remains in place for a set number of spins |
| Walking Wild | Moves one reel per spin until it exits the grid |
| Multiplier Wild | Multiplies the value of any win it contributes to |
Multipliers
Multipliers amplify your winnings by a set factor — 2×, 3×, 5×, or even higher in some games. They can appear:
- As part of a Wild symbol
- During free spins rounds (often increasing with each consecutive win)
- As part of an Avalanche or Cascading Reels mechanic
- During a dedicated bonus round
Pick-and-Click Bonus Rounds
These are second-screen bonus games where you select from a set of hidden objects to reveal prizes, multipliers, or extra spins. They add an interactive element to gameplay and can feel like a mini-game within the slot itself. The key thing to understand: the prizes are pre-determined by the game's RNG — your "choice" doesn't change the mathematical outcome, but the experience feels engaging.
Megaways™ and Bonus Buy
Megaways™ is a dynamic reel mechanic (licensed from Big Time Gaming) where the number of symbols on each reel changes with every spin, creating thousands — sometimes hundreds of thousands — of ways to win. Many Megaways™ games feature escalating free-spin multipliers that make the bonus round extremely high-variance but high-potential.
Bonus Buy (also called Feature Buy) lets players pay a premium — typically 50–100× the base bet — to directly enter the bonus round, bypassing the base game trigger entirely. It's a feature for players who want to experience bonus content directly, but it's important to note it comes with significantly higher risk per activation.
Tips for Bonus Feature Hunting
- Check the game's paytable before playing — it details every bonus feature and how it's triggered.
- Understand the feature's hit rate: some bonuses trigger every 100 spins, others every 400+.
- Look for games where the bonus round has clear upside potential — multipliers, extra wilds, or retriggering spins.
- Play demo mode to experience the bonus features without financial risk first.
